i2c, Sightline Team Up For Cashless Cross-Channel Gaming 

PYMNTS

Its client roster includes MGM Resorts, Caesars Resorts, and Hard Rock Hotel and Casino; the Oregon and Pennsylvania state lotteries; Churchill Downs; Golden Nugget online; and DraftKings, FanDuel, William Hill, and Rush Street sports, among others. Founded in 2010, Sightline has experienced 744 percent revenue growth since 2015.

Walmart Will Add Shelf-Scanning Robots To More US Stores

PYMNTS

Shoppers reportedly gawked at the time that the retailer put the first robot in a rural Pennsylvania store in 2016. The new robots become a part of the increasingly automated workforce of Walmart that also encompasses devices to unload trucks, collect online grocery orders and scrub floors.
